Loughborough lie in 4th position after 26 games on 53 points, whereas Sutton sit just below the top half of the table in 11th place, and with 36 points after the same number of games.
Sutton’s main problem in recent months has been scoring goals, netting just two in their last 4 games in the league. Worrying! Especially as the chasing pack are getting close, and to finish below the top 10 would be a travesty after the start they had under Cameron Stewart’s reign.
Loughborough Dynamo are based in Leicestershire and play at the Nanpantan Sports Ground. They are nicknamed the Moes and were founded in 1955.
The club was established by pupils from Loughborough Grammar school who were rebelling against the school’s rugby only policy and secretly formed a football team.
The Moes took their name from Dynamo Moscow who had recently visited England to play Wolverhampton Wanderers. They play in a gold and black home strip (taken from Wolverhampton Wanderers), and a green and white away strip
